What is the North Carolina Child Support Worksheet B?
The North Carolina Child Support Worksheet B is a specific legal document utilized to determine child support obligations, particularly in cases involving parents with joint or shared physical custody. This worksheet plays a crucial role in calculating these obligations by taking into account various financial factors affected by the custody arrangement. It is employed in both civil and criminal cases to establish enforceable child support orders, ensuring that the financial responsibilities towards children are adequately addressed.

Who is eligible to use the Child Support Worksheet B?
The North Carolina Child Support Worksheet B is intended for parents with joint or shared physical custody who need to calculate their child support obligations.
What information do I need to complete the form?
You will need financial details such as both parents' monthly gross income, child care costs, health insurance expenses, and the breakdown of custody time shared between parents.

What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the worksheet?
Common mistakes include incorrect income reporting, failing to detail all relevant expenses, and not accurately reflecting the custody time split. Double-check your entries for accuracy.

Do I need to notarize the worksheet?
No, the North Carolina Child Support Worksheet B does not require notarization, but check for any specific local requirements or recommendations.
